Weather Summary
Weather Underground midday recap for Saturday, February 11, 2012.

Cold air poured into the Plains on Saturday, while snow showers developed in parts of the Northeast. A strong low pressure system that brought heavy rain to the Southern Plains and Southeast has advanced eastward and off the East Coast into the Atlantic Ocean. However, counter-clockwise flow around this system continued to push moisture into the Northeast, Great Lakes, and Ohio River Valley. In addition to cool air over the region, this allowed for snow showers to develop across Michigan and the Ohio River Valley. Snowfall accumulations ranged from 1 to 3 inches in most areas, with up to 5 inches at higher elevations of the Central Appalachians. Coastal regions remained slightly warmer, which maintained light rain showers from southern Maine through Virginia.

Behind this system, a dominant ridge of high pressure continued to build over the Plains. This system started to stretch eastward over the Mississippi Valley. Flow around this system pulled cold air in from central Canada and kept seasonable cool temperatures over the Central US. High temperatures only reached into the 30s in parts of northern Texas, while the Central and Northern Plains saw highs in the teens, with overnight lows in the negative teens.

Out West, cool conditions persisted with areas of wet weather as a trough of low pressure moved over the Pacific Northwest and into the Intermountain West and Great Basin. Rainfall totals and high elevation snow accumulation remained light. A few light rain showers extended into California as moist onshore flow persisted.

Wind Chill Advisory
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 2:12 PM EST on February 11, 2012

... Wind Chill Advisory in effect from 3 am to 8 am EST Sunday...

The National Weather Service in Tampa Bay area - Ruskin FL has
issued a Wind Chill Advisory... which is in effect from 3 am to
8 am EST Sunday.

* Wind chill values... 15 to 25 degrees are expected from Hernando
County north and 25 to 35 degrees from Pasco south late tonight
and early Sunday morning.


Precautionary/preparedness actions...

A Wind Chill Advisory is issued when wind chill index values will
drop to 35 or lower... except 25 or lower across the Nature Coast
and Sumter County.











High Surf Advisory
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 3:35 PM EST on February 11, 2012

... High surf advisory now in effect until 4 PM EST Sunday...

The high surf advisory is now in effect until 4 PM EST Sunday.

* Waves and surf: northwesterly winds of 15 to 25 mph will result
in surf of 4 to 6 feet.

* Timing: strong rip currents and high surf will continue to
impact the coast through Sunday morning... then slowly diminish
during the afternoon.

* Impacts: high surf will produce dangerous surf and rip
currents at the beaches. People visiting the beaches should
stay out of the high surf.

Precautionary/preparedness actions...

A high surf advisory is issued when dangerous water action is
expected along the coast. This includes rough surf... large
breaking waves... rip currents... and strong undertow.

Beach goers are urged to heed lifeguard warnings.
